High spin resonances in 12C+12C scattering

摘要
We report on new experimental data which reveal high spin resonances in C-12 +C-12 scattering. We have measured excitation functions for the C-12 [C-12, C-12(3(1)(-)) + C-12(3(1)(-))] reaction over the centre of mass energy range E-c.m.= 31 to 45 MeV. Resonances have been observed at E-c.m.= 32.5, 37.5 and 43 MeV. Detailed angular correlation measurements have been performed at the energy corresponding to the peak of each resonance. From an analysis of the angular correlations we suggest a dominant angular momentum of J = 22 at the highest energy. We interpret the results in terms of an alpha cluster model of superdeformed states in Mg-24. (C) 1998 Elsevier Science B.V. All rights reserved.
